diff --git a/gdk/gdkdevicemanager.c b/gdk/gdkdevicemanager.c index 0e30df17f8..bd22b491d8 100644 --- a/gdk/gdkdevicemanager.c +++ b/gdk/gdkdevicemanager.c @@ -238,30 +238,3 @@ gdk_device_manager_get_display (GdkDeviceManager *device_manager) return device_manager->display; } - -/** - * gdk_device_manager_list_devices: - * @device_manager: a #GdkDeviceManager - * @type: device type to get. - * - * Returns the list of devices of type @type currently attached to - * @device_manager. - * - * Returns: (transfer container) (element-type Gdk.Device): a list of - * #GdkDevices. The returned list must be - * freed with g_list_free (). The list elements are owned by - * GTK+ and must not be freed or unreffed. - * - * Since: 3.0 - * - * Deprecated: 3.20, use gdk_seat_get_pointer(), gdk_seat_get_keyboard() - * and gdk_seat_get_slaves() instead. - **/ -GList * -gdk_device_manager_list_devices (GdkDeviceManager *device_manager, - GdkDeviceType type) -{ - g_return_val_if_fail (GDK_IS_DEVICE_MANAGER (device_manager), NULL); - - return GDK_DEVICE_MANAGER_GET_CLASS (device_manager)->list_devices (device_manager, type); -} diff --git a/gdk/gdkdevicemanager.h b/gdk/gdkdevicemanager.h index 547e2e86a3..af6793f16a 100644 --- a/gdk/gdkdevicemanager.h +++ b/gdk/gdkdevicemanager.h @@ -35,8 +35,6 @@ G_BEGIN_DECLS GType gdk_device_manager_get_type (void) G_GNUC_CONST; GdkDisplay * gdk_device_manager_get_display (GdkDeviceManager *device_manager); -GList * gdk_device_manager_list_devices (GdkDeviceManager *device_manager, - GdkDeviceType type); G_END_DECLS